Well, it's not a 1987 Lemans RS.

Cosmetic/graphics differences:
1987 RS had a red Tange 2 sticker on the seat tube. OP's bike sure looks like it has an Infinity sticker there.
The fork on the RS had yellow inside the crown cutouts, Mangalloy stickers, and "Centurion" on the flat crown.
Other frame graphics look the same.
The OP's bike has no top tube decal left, which is odd because it was under the clear coat.

Component differences:
1987 RS did not have a Tange headset like that. It may have been Tange, but it was not labeled in any way, and the lower race was squared off.
Wheels are N/A, because those are obviously not the OEM wheels. OEM on the RS were bronze Araya 700c.
Brakeset on the RS was Exage SLR. This brakeset is DC, very similar to the brakeset on the '86 Ironman, but not exactly. I figure a replacement.
Housing on the RS was red, which in sunlight over time = pink.
1987 Lemans RS had 2x7 indexed LX100 shifters, FD, RD. The OP appears to be 2x6.
1987 Lemans RS had a slightly darker crankset, not a brightly polished crankset, if I recall.

This could be a "straight" Lemans, which I've never seen, from 1987.

This could also be a Lemans/Lemans RS from 1986, which would have put it one step below the Elite RS, two below the Ironman. The Infinity sticker lends support to 1986, as do the DC calipers, but white hoods? I doubt it.

Only a catalog would know for sure, but the next post could be right on the money. I've not seen a black Accordo, and know little about that model.
